Vente-Farine
Vente-Farine is a peak in Thézan-des-Corbières, Arrondissement of Narbonne, Occitanie and has an elevation of 378 metres. Vente-Farine is situated nearby to the locality Plat de la Fin, as well as near Poursan.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Talairan
Photo: MathieuMD,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Talairan is a small village of only a few hundred people in Aude, a Department of Languedoc-Rousillon in France. Talairan is set in the heartland of the wine-growing Corbieres district.
